The program instrument for Structural Policies for Pre Accession (short ISPA, German structure-political instrument for preparation for the entry) is one of three instruments, with which the European union supports the entry preparations of the candidate countries in central and Eastern Europe (Bulgaria, Czech republic, Estonia, Hungary, Latvia, Litauen, Poland, Romania, Slowakei and Slowenien). Therefore the requirement expires with the final entry of a country. Legal basis of ISPA is the regulation (EEC) No. 1267/1999 of the advice from 21 June 1999 over a structure-political instrument for preparation on the entry.
In addition of the programs ISPA serves PHARE and SAPARD for the structure-political promotion of infrastructure projects within the ranges environment and traffic and for the improvement of the economic and social coherence within these ranges. For the period 2000 to 2006 it is annually equipped with 1,04 billion EUR. Promoted measures must stand in conformity with the obligations of the entry partnership as well as with the national efforts for the conversion of the joint possession conditions in the agreement.
The promoted projects (with a minimum volume of 5 millions EUR) are accomplished by public or similar mechanisms, which are assigned by the responsible national authorities (a kind ISPA co-ordination department). The member countries are thereby in relation to the commission (central management regional policy) accountable.
After receipt the requests for promotion from the which are applicable countries the commission makes a decision after statement of her administrative committee (representative of the member states under presidency of a Kommissionsvertreters) over measures which can be financed.
The promotion takes place as not repayable direct support, as repayable support or in other form. Are financed up to 75% of the costs of the project, an increase on 85% by the administrative committee of the commission is possible. The height of the financing is adapted in accordance with the Kofinanzierung. Preliminary studies and measures of the technical aid, which are accomplished on initiative of the commission, can be financed at a value of up to 100% of the reimbursable total costs.
The European parliament, the Council of Ministers, which becomes economics and social committee and the committee of the regions informed by the commission annually about the ISPA supporting measures.
